titleOfInvention Blue ray reinforcing therapeutic apparatus
abstract A blue ray reinforcing therapeutic apparatus relates to a treatment apparatus and comprises a blue ray therapeutic instrument having a jaundice phototherapy case and a bottom case, wherein the jaundice phototherapy case is fixedly mounted on the bottom case, and blue ray emitting sources are respectively arranged on the upper and lower surfaces of the jaundice phototherapy case. The blue ray reinforcing treatment apparatus further comprises phototherapy plates respectively arranged on the periphery of the jaundice phototherapy case. The phototherapy plates are provided with blue ray emitting sources respectively facing the jaundice phototherapy case. Illumination surfaces can be opened for carrying out comprehensive illumination treatment for children, thereby substantially shortening phototherapy time, increasing light source and phototherapy intensity and irradiation area. The bilirubin in blood can be reduced rapidly, and neonatal jaundice can be cured rapidly, thereby improving phototherapy effects.
